Slaan posted:

I saw a recommendation this morning on a website saying the new podcast limetown was really good and that it hits the same kind of notes that WTNV does. Has anyone listened to it yet? I've downloaded the first episode to listen to at the gym later.

Just imagine Serial but instead of investigating an old murder, they were investigating the disappearance of a whole research facility/community and all the people in it. It seems like it is going in a strong sci fi direction, which seems promising.

In practice, I don't really get much WTNV from it. Instead of the folksy weird community-radio-from-the-Twilight-Zone vibe that Nightvale has, it's a faux NPR investigation into some sci fi stuff. It's going to be a limited story so its very focused. It's not much of a spoiler to say that if the end of the second episode is any indication, it's going to be more sinister than WTNV usually gets.

If you enjoyed Serial and think it would be cool if the story was sci fi, you'd probably like it. I think its cool. There is also the Black Tapes Podcast which seemed like Serial + Ghosts, but I wasn't a huge fan of the voice acting in that one. The writing seemed strong, though.
